Analysis
The most recent figure for emissions on agricultural land — emissions (co2eq) in Oceania is 303,611 kt, measured in 2023.
The figure is up 36.7% on the previous year and up 29.2% over ten years.
Over the whole period, emissions on agricultural land — emissions (co2eq) in Oceania peaked at 398,348 kt in 2001 and was at its lowest, 214,675 kt, in 2020.
That places Oceania 21st out of 32 groups with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ently falling across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
